Top 5 Mistakes to Avoid with Advance Funding for Cases
Advance funding for legal cases can be a lifeline for plaintiffs waiting for a settlement. However, there are common mistakes that can undermine its benefits. Here are the top five mistakes to avoid when considering advance funding for cases.
Not Understanding the Terms
One of the biggest mistakes is not fully understanding the terms of the advance funding agreement. Ensure you know the interest rates, fees, and repayment obligations before signing.
Choosing the Wrong Provider
Selecting an unreliable funding provider can lead to unexpected issues. Research potential companies, check reviews, and verify their credibility.
Borrowing More Than Necessary
Taking more money than you need might seem tempting, but it can lead to higher costs in the long run. Borrow only what is necessary and sustainable.
Ignoring Legal Advice
Disregarding your attorney's advice can be detrimental. Your lawyer can provide valuable insights into whether advance funding is suitable for your case.
Failing to Plan for Repayment
Finally, failing to plan for repayment can cause financial stress. Understand the repayment structure and prepare for it to avoid complications post-settlement.
